#ca2156 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ca2156 is composed of 79.2% red, 12.9%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.7% magenta, 57.4%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 341.2 degrees, a saturation of 71.9% and a lightness of 46.1%. #ca2156 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ff42ac with #950000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#ca2156 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ca2156 has RGB values of R:202, G:33,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.84, Y:0.57,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13246806.
